Teaching comes with many of the additional benefits of most careers. Again, this can vary widely depending on where you work, but generally speaking, teachers are entitled to insurance for themselves and their families, including medical, dental and vision coverage. They are also entitled to sick days and paid leave.

Is a school teacher a good career?

A career in teaching is one of the most recession-proof jobs according to CNBC News. Also, job growth is expected to see a steady increase, on par with the national average, with 1.9 million new job openings for teachers between 2014 and 2024, according to the U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ics (BLS).

How would you prepare yourself to become a professional teacher?

Have a bachelor’s degree. Complete an accredited teacher preparation program. Pass a criminal background check. Earn sufficient scores on basic skills and/or subject matter exams, such as the Praxis Core, Praxis Subject Assessments or the Praxis Knowledge for Teaching Test.

What is the demand for history teachers?

History Teacher Job Growth According to the U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ics (BLS), jobs for middle school history teachers are expected to increase by 4\% from 2019 to 2029, which is average job growth. The job growth percentage rate for high school history teachers is the same at 4\% increase for 2019 to 2029.

What is the job description of a history teacher?

History teachers work within private and public schools, as well as colleges and universities. You’ll be in charge of a classroom of students and will spend the school year teaching them about specific aspects of history, like European history or U.S. history.

Do you need a license to teach history?

A state-issued teaching certificate or license is also required; however, some private schools do not specify a teaching credential as a job prerequisite. Some states require a master’s degree for middle and high school teachers; and most postsecondary schools require at least a master’s degree in order to teach history.
